Leibin Wang is a scholar working on Atmospheric Science, Global and Planetary Change and Paleontology. According to data from OpenAlex, Leibin Wang has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 742 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Atmospheric Science, 13 papers in Global and Planetary Change and 9 papers in Paleontology. Recurrent topics in Leibin Wang’s work include Geology and Paleoclimatology Research (19 papers), Archaeology and ancient environmental studies (9 papers) and Landslides and related hazards (6 papers). Leibin Wang is often cited by papers focused on Geology and Paleoclimatology Research (19 papers), Archaeology and ancient environmental studies (9 papers) and Landslides and related hazards (6 papers). Leibin Wang coll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Leibin Wang's co-authors include Xiaoyan Zhang, Yanzhuang Wang, Fahu Chen, Jie Li, Qigen Lin, Jia Jia, Michael E. Bekier, Eija Jokitalo, Yanwu Duan and Guoqiang Li and has published in prestigious journ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, Remote Sensing of Environment and Earth and Planetary Science Letters.
